问题标签 [realbasic]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
1504 浏览

sqlite - XOJO 从 SQLite 数据库中删除一条记录

我正在使用 Xojo 2013 版本 1。我正在尝试从 SQLite 数据库中删除一条记录。但我失败得很惨。它没有删除记录,而是出于某种原因复制了它。

这是我使用的代码:

我正在动态生成命令。但是我改变它总是一样的。带或不带引号的结果相同。

有任何想法吗?

0 投票
4 回答
3284 浏览

realbasic - XOJO简单文件拷贝

我想要完成的非常基本的事情。

A 具有存储为字符串(简单路径)的文件(图像)源。

我想将该文件复制到自定义目标。更准确地说是位于应用程序根目录中的文件夹名称图像。我检查了文档,所有这些都引用了 FolderItem 类,不幸的是,我无法弄清楚。

有任何想法吗?

0 投票
3 回答
951 浏览

string - 从字符串 realbasic 中删除一个字符

我在 RealBasic 中创建了一个虚拟键盘。当我按下字母时,我将数字附加到文本字段中,一切正常,但是,当我从虚拟键盘按下“删除”按钮时,如何从当前光标位置删除该文本字段中的字符?

要将字母或数字附加到我使用的文本字段:

0 投票
3 回答
421 浏览

database - 我可以将 SQLite 数据库存储在另一个 SQLite 数据库中吗?

我实际上使用的是旧版本的 Realbasic (2008),并且一直在使用 VB 脚本将几个小型数据库备份为 Zip 文件。

我现在发现 thnis 方法在 Windows 8 上不起作用,也不是跨平台的。

因为我希望备份在单个文件中以便它可以是增量的,所以我想使用一个大型数据库来保存较小的副本。

这可能吗?

我无意为此购买插件。

0 投票
1 回答
655 浏览

listbox - 在分层列表框中填充文件夹

我正在使用文件夹和文件填充分层列表框。我用这些代码行填充我的列表框:

General.GetBlocksFolder 是一个在我的系统上保存文件夹信息的对象。BlockList 是在我的程序中显示“块”的列表。这按预期工作,我看到该列表中的文件夹。

然后,当我展开一行时,我使用以下代码:

这很好用,但是当我深入到 3 个级别时,我得到一个错误。'CurrentRow' 上的 nilObjectException

有谁知道这是什么法术?

提前感谢马蒂亚斯

0 投票
2 回答
535 浏览

php - 数组中的 REALbasic 数组

我正在尝试在REALbasic中编写一个肥皂参数。

我需要在另一个类似于php的数组中添加一个数组:

所以我可以通过这个:

我有

但收到一个“ Type mismatch error. Expected String, but got String(,)

我怎样才能做到这一点。

谢谢

0 投票
1 回答
365 浏览

oop - 从属性调用类方法时出现 REALBasic/Xojo NilObjectException

我正在编写一个用于基于 UDP 的聊天的控制台应用程序。

我有一个名为 App 的类,它的 Super 是 ConsoleApplication(“主”类)和一个 UDPInterface 类,它的 Super 是 EasyUDPSocket。在 App 类中,有一个名为 UDP 的属性,其类型为 UDPInterface(UDP As UDPInterface)。在 Run 事件处理程序中,有以下代码:

UDPInterface的GetIP方法由以下代码组成(返回类型为String):

LocalAddress 是一个 EasyUDPSocket 方法,它只是检索内部 IP。

我遇到的问题是,当我调用 UDP.GetIP 时,程序返回 NilObjectException。我需要将 UDPInterface 类用作属性,以便它的属性在 App 内的所有方法中都一样。

0 投票
1 回答
871 浏览

forms - Realbasic 如何在代码中提交 HTML 表单

我正在努力解决如何使用代码单击 HTML 表单上的“提交”按钮。我似乎能够使用 HTTPSocket 设置变量 - 名称、电子邮件等,但是当套接字“发布”时它不会触发提交。

任何帮助将不胜感激

干杯,

艾伦麦克塔维什...

RB 2008 r1 ...请不要插件。

你好,我们又见面了,

我使用的代码是软件给出的示例 - HTTP Example.rbp。它读取网站代码并要求我提供 HTML 中输入字段的值。但是,表格似乎没有提交。

服务器上的 HTML 如下:

我强调这不是我的代码。

我想知道我是否需要让我的朋友在网站上使用不同的设置。也许一些 PHP 或其他什么。

与往常一样,任何帮助都感激不尽。

艾伦...

0 投票
1 回答
1044 浏览

video - 如何从网络摄像头保存图片

我正在使用 Aaron Ballman 的 Windows 功能套件从我的网络摄像头捕获视频。它工作正常,但... webcam.startpreview 启动出现的相机图像,webcam.stoppreview 照它说的那样做并停止视频。

我的问题是,在 stoppreview 之后,我在画布控件中留下了一张静止图像,我需要知道如何将该图像保存到磁盘 - 最好是作为 jpg 文件。

0 投票
1 回答
784 浏览

mysql - 使用 Postgres 和 Xojo 的图片

我已经从 MySQL 数据库转换为 Postgres。在转换过程中,Postgres 中的图片列被创建为 bytea。

此 Xojo 代码适用于 MySQL,但不适用于 Postgres。

有任何想法吗?